California Verbal Discipline Warning Documentation Checklist: Detailed Description and Types In California, employers are required to follow specific guidelines when dealing with disciplinary actions, including verbal warnings. To ensure compliance with state labor laws and maintain consistency in disciplinary practices, it is crucial for employers to utilize a California Verbal Discipline Warning Documentation Checklist. A California Verbal Discipline Warning Documentation Checklist serves as a useful tool for employers to record and document verbal warnings given to employees effectively. It consists of various key elements that need to be addressed while issuing verbal warnings. By adhering to this checklist, employers can ensure that fair and consistent practices are followed throughout the disciplinary process. Key elements that may be included in a California Verbal Discipline Warning Documentation Checklist are: 1. Employee Information: The checklist should require the employee's name, position, department, and supervisor's information. 2. Incident Details: A section focusing on the specifics of the incident that led to the verbal warning should be included. This may involve the date, time, location, and a detailed description of the behavior or performance issue. 3. Witnesses, if applicable: Is there were any witnesses to the incident, their names and statements should be documented to provide a more comprehensive picture of the situation. 4. Explanation: The checklist should include a space for the supervisor to provide a clear explanation of the reasons for the verbal warning. This explanation should be concise and focused on objective facts. 5. Employee Acknowledgment: There should be a section for the employee to acknowledge receipt of the verbal warning. Their signature and the date of acknowledgment should be recorded. 6. Additional Actions: If any additional actions were discussed as a result of the verbal warning, such as training or mentoring, they should be noted for reference. 7. Follow-up Plan: The checklist may include a section to outline a follow-up plan, specifying any expectations, goals, or improvements that need to be achieved within a given timeframe. Different types of California Verbal Discipline Warning Documentation Checklists may exist based on specific workplace regulations, company policies, or industry requirements. For example: 1. General Verbal Discipline Warning Documentation Checklist: This checklist covers the basic elements discussed above and can be implemented across various industries. 2. Performance-related Verbal Discipline Warning Documentation Checklist: This checklist focuses on addressing employee performance issues, such as poor productivity, quality, or meeting deadlines. It may include additional sections related to performance improvement plans, goals, and monitoring mechanisms. 3. Behavior-related Verbal Discipline Warning Documentation Checklist: This checklist is designed to address behavioral issues, such as inappropriate conduct, insubordination, or violating workplace policies. It may include sections for outlining expected behavioral changes and consequences for non-compliance. 4. Compliance-specific Verbal Discipline Warning Documentation Checklist: Certain industries, such as healthcare or finance, may require specific checklists to ensure proper adherence to industry regulations and standards. Employers should choose the appropriate California Verbal Discipline Warning Documentation Checklist that aligns with their specific needs while adhering to state labor laws. These checklists play a crucial role in maintaining a fair and transparent approach to employee discipline and can serve as essential evidence in case of any legal disputes.

Does a verbal warning need to be documented? A verbal warning should definitely be documented. Employers should keep the documentation of the verbal warning in their informal notes, and you as the employee should sign the documentation to indicate that you have received it.

Documenting a Verbal WarningThe verbal warning is documented by the supervisor in their informal notes about the efforts provided to help the employee improve. If the verbal warning is not documented, with the employee's signature indicating they have received it, it may as well not exist.

What to Include in a Disciplinary FormThe employee's name and the date of the write-up.Clearly state why they are being written up.How many times this employee has been written up.Clearly state details about the problem.Give the employee a deadline to fix the problem.Always have them sign and date the write-up.

A disciplinary action is a reprimand or corrective action in response to employee misconduct, rule violation, or poor performance. Depending on the severity of the case, a disciplinary action can take different forms, including: A verbal warning. A written warning.

Best Practices in Documenting Employee DisciplineHave an employee discipline form.Conduct a full and fair investigation.Get the facts.Be objective.Be clear and specific.Complete the form while the facts are fresh.Get the employee's acknowledgement.Allow the employee to explain the conduct.More items...?15-Jan-2009

Documenting meetings and incidents helps ensure clear communication. A written record creates definite proof of what an employee was told and helps eliminate the potential for miscommunication between the institution and the employee.

With clear documentation of the behavior, you can notify the employee of your intent to discuss their performance and schedule a meeting to issue a verbal warning. Depending on your organization's particular policies, you may send a formal notice or speak with them privately to confirm they understand your intent.

A verbal warning is usually an informal warning. Even though it's not a formal written warning, it's still a good idea to document a verbal warning. This information helps you track the employee's development, and it can be important if you fire the employee in the future.

How to document employee performance issuesStick to the facts and underline expectations.Emphasize behavior.Align records of past performance.Describe proof of misconduct.Identify and present consequences.Meet in person and get a signature.
